Forward ports from machine to a workspace
 
Usage:
coder port-forward <workspace> [flags]
 
Aliases:
port-forward, tunnel
 
Get Started:
- Port forward a single TCP port from 1234 in the workspace to port 5678 on
your local machine:
 
$ coder port-forward <workspace> --tcp 5678:1234
 
- Port forward a single UDP port from port 9000 to port 9000 on your local
machine:
 
$ coder port-forward <workspace> --udp 9000
 
- Port forward multiple TCP ports and a UDP port:
 
$ coder port-forward <workspace> --tcp 8080:8080 --tcp 9000:3000 --udp 5353:53
 
- Port forward multiple ports (TCP or UDP) in condensed syntax:
 
$ coder port-forward <workspace> --tcp 8080,9000:3000,9090-9092,10000-10002:10010-10012
 
Flags:
-h, --help help for port-forward
-p, --tcp stringArray Forward TCP port(s) from the workspace to the local machine.
Consumes $CODER_PORT_FORWARD_TCP
--udp stringArray Forward UDP port(s) from the workspace to the local machine. The UDP
connection has TCP-like semantics to support stateful UDP protocols.
Consumes $CODER_PORT_FORWARD_UDP
 
Global Flags:
--global-config coder Path to the global coder config directory.
Consumes $CODER_CONFIG_DIR (default "/tmp/coder-cli-test-config")
--header stringArray HTTP headers added to all requests. Provide as "Key=Value".
Consumes $CODER_HEADER
--no-feature-warning Suppress warnings about unlicensed features.
Consumes $CODER_NO_FEATURE_WARNING
--no-version-warning Suppress warning when client and server versions do not match.
Consumes $CODER_NO_VERSION_WARNING
--token string Specify an authentication token. For security reasons setting
CODER_SESSION_TOKEN is preferred.
Consumes $CODER_SESSION_TOKEN
--url string URL to a deployment.
Consumes $CODER_URL
-v, --verbose Enable verbose output.
Consumes $CODER_VERBOSE
